A number of the Malaysian victims in the MH17 disaster come home today. I would like to thank the people of Holland for treating the remains of all the victims in this tragedy with a great deal of dignity and care.
Today has been declared an official day of mourning in Malaysia. Everyone has been requested to maintain a minute's silence between 10.45 a.m. and 11.15 a.m., when a Malaysia Airlines Boeing 747- 400F freighter is expected to arrive at Kuala Lumpur International Airport from Amsterdam with the remains of some of the Malaysian victims. There is a terrible sense of sadness here in Malaysia for the loss of both MH17 and MH370. Many of the staff at my office are wearing black today in respect for the victims of MH17.
